1950 - Residents of the northeastern U.S. observed a blue sun and a blue moon, caused by forest fires in British Columbia.

Lydick is an unincorporated community in Warren Township, St. Joseph County, in the U.S. state of Indiana.
The community is part of the South Bend–Mishawaka, IN-MI, Metropolitan Statistical Area.
